It’s a condition called “foot drop.” The kick deadened the nerve and he was no longer able to lift the front of his foot off the ground. It eventually went away.

This is the correct answer. FWIW the nerve that was injured is the common peroneal nerve. It courses around the fibula just below the outside of the knee, and one of those early kicks must have hit it perfectly. Rogan was instinctively correct that the redness behind/around Cejudo's knee was related to his ankle/foot problem, though he had no idea why.
